Property description

Tenure: Freehold

A beautifully refurbished, chain free Victorian terrace.

 

Internally the property measures 1169 sq. ft and benefits from three bedrooms, large reception rooms, a kitchen/diner, downstairs WC, utility room and a sunny westerly facing garden which backs onto Brookmill Park.

 

This beautiful Victorian house has two bright and airy reception rooms boasting high ceilings, bespoke fitted storage, high skirting boards, real wooden flooring and a charming working marble fireplace. The kitchen/diner has been tastefully refurbished with marble worktops, is fully equipped with built in appliances, lots of storage and space for a dining table to entertain your guests. The garden is accessed via the French doors which is a blank canvass for a new buyer to put their own stamp on this wonderful home.

 

Heading upstairs to the first floor you will find the master bedroom benefiting from built-in wardrobes, a feature fireplace, wooden floors and large sash windows which let in plenty of natural light. Next to the master bedroom is probably one of the most luxurious bathrooms we have seen this year. This beautiful four piece bathroom has been tastefully designed with a free standing bath, walk-in shower, marble worktop & splash back around the sink and oversized porcelain tiles on floor. Down the hall is the second and third bedrooms along with another stylish family bathroom. There is also scope to extend this property subject to planning.

 

Lewisham station is a 10-minute walk away with regular connections to London Bridge in as little as 8 minutes, Cannon Street in 15 minutes, Charring Cross 18 minutes and Victoria in 25 minutes. For access to Canary Wharf, you can pick up the DLR from Lewisham which has fast and frequent services in as little as 15 minutes.  Additionally St Johns station is a 7 minute walk away with direct trains to London Bridge and the DLR is a one minute walk away.


There are highly sought-after primary schools within a short walk from the property that are rated Ofsted good. Ashmead Primary, Morden Mount, St Stephen’s are popular with the local families.

 

Brookmill Park is on your doorstep and is home to lots of wildlife habitats, the River Ravesbourne and a play park. Location is key, and this property does not disappoint! Deptford High Street, Greenwich and Lewisham town centres are all within a 10/15-minute walk away. Deptford Hight Street is home to Deptford Market Yard with a vibrant collection of independent shops, bars, restaurants and cafés.
